Prof. Dr. Ioannis Tzanavaros is a highly experienced adult and pediatric cardiac surgeon and currently serves as the Director of the Cardiac Innovation Center at Apollonion Private Hospital in Cyprus. With decades of international surgical experience and advanced training in Germany, he is recognized for his expertise in complex heart surgery, congenital heart disease treatment, and minimally invasive cardiac procedures.
Originally from Polis Chrysochous, Cyprus, Dr. Tzanavaros studied medicine at the National and Kapodistrian University of Athens. After completing his medical education and military service, he began his specialization in cardiac surgery at Cottbus, an academic hospital associated with the German Cardiac Surgery Center in Berlin.
He completed his specialization in cardiac surgery in 2007, the same year he successfully defended his doctoral dissertation on the surgical treatment of arrhythmias. Following his specialization, he continued to build an outstanding international career in Germany.
In 2010, he became a Consultant in Cardiac Surgery in Stuttgart, and by 2012, he was certified as a Congenital Heart Surgeon and Pediatric Cardiac Surgeon. His expertise led to his appointment as Deputy Director of Congenital Heart Surgery at the University Clinic of Hannover, one of Europe’s leading cardiac centers.
In 2016, he became the Director of Pediatric Cardiac Surgery and Congenital Heart Surgery in Stuttgart, Germany, where he performed highly complex procedures and advanced surgical treatments for children and adults with congenital heart defects.
Throughout his career, Prof. Dr. Tzanavaros has performed more than 3,000 heart surgeries, treating patients ranging from premature infants weighing as little as 400 grams to elderly adults. He is also considered a pioneer in minimally invasive congenital cardiac surgery, helping improve recovery times and surgical outcomes for patients worldwide.

Consultation fees for cardiology and cardiovascular surgery in Cyprus vary based on the doctor’s seniority, facility type, and diagnostic inclusions. In private clinics, the consultation cost of cardiologists in Cyprus typically depends on the complexity of the case, additional imaging tests (like ECG or echocardiography), and whether the visit is in-person or via telemedicine. Public facilities under GeSY often offer reduced fees for insured patients.
